BANGKOK: It was a week before the late Thai King Bhumibol Adulyadej's funeral when I arrived in Thailand for a conference and I did not expect that my world would turn black for the next week.
On my first morning (Oct 15) in Bangkok, I was awoken by the sounds of blasting cannons coming from the Grand Palace where the late king's body has lain in state since his death.
